what is the maintenance like for a nitro? if it sits for long periods of time, does something need to be run through it so it doesnt gunk up or corrode in the motor?

Maintenence is pretty low IMO....after run oil procedure post running it...takes about 1 minute to do and some argue it isnt needed depending on fuel you use. Youll want to flush the engine/tank/lines if its gonna sit for months at a time yes, but again....not intensive maintnence there either.
I think the added maintenence is due to more mechanical pieces to keep up on....mechanical brakes, clutch, pipe. If maintenence worries you, nitro isnt really for you....since the maintenence on nitro is a lot of the reason people enjoy them.

RE: Which truck?
I would pass on the 2350....at some point you are probably going to want to at least try the savage on 6s...even if you dont want to run it a lot on 6s, the temptation will be hard to ward off...and of course you dont have that option with the 2350. If you go brushless savage...I say get the flux.
